Browns CB Sheldon Brown suffered a groin injury in Sunday's win over the Dolphins. Prior to leaving, Brown was getting picked on by Chad Henne as Joe Haden locked up Brandon Marshall across the field. Brown was replaced by Buster Skrine. His status for Week 4 is unclear. Josh Cribbs was held out of special teams work Sunday due to a groin injury Cribbs was healthy enough to get a full complement of snaps at wideout, catching a 33-yard touchdown pass in the second quarter over Sean Smith. But Jordan Norwood and Buster Skrine filled in on returns. Look for Cribbs to miss some more practice time this week We need Cribbs back returning.. he brings that... Of the Bengals, Colts, Dolphins and Titans: The Titans have the best record, the best point differential (+14 to the Bengals +3, ours is -1 by comparison) Things playing in our favor, Chris Johnson is averaging a meager 2.1 yards a carry... the Browns will need to contain him or this game could give us Miami flashbacks. Miami didn't light us up on the ground but they consistently ran for 5+ yards at will when they handed the ball off to their rookie back. We looked good because they didn't get any big ones on us. Kenny Britt is gone for the year, that's something we can focus on, that means Haden will likely be paired off against Nate Washington. Britt, Washington and Chris Johnson have caught 51 of Hasselbeck's 78 completions this season so they're down one of those major options. If nobody can step up they're playing with a HUGE gap in their passing game. Their D has 6 sacks so far this season, we nearly had that many against Miami alone. I hope our line can hold up against their pass-rush, as we NEED to get Colt time to make throws, if he gets out of his element early and he's forced to play aggressive, we could see another ugly game this week. Edit: Another point, we give our O-line a hard time but opposing teams have only sacked Colt THREE times all season thus far... They're getting pressure on Colt but they're not taking him down.
